Two suspected drug dealers are behind bars in Washington County facing multiple charges.
Sheriff Thomas Smith tells NewsCentral, 32-year old Sherman Sentelle Lawrence of Warthen and 30-year old Zinta Neal of Wrens, were taken into custody on Tuesday.
Smith says the pair was arrested at a home on Mt. Zion Road in Warthen after deputies served a search warrant.
During the search officers discovered 27 grams of crack cocaine, marijuana, digital scales, a smoking device, and money.
Lawrence and Neal are both charged with Violation of Georgia Controlled Substance Act, Possession of Crack Cocaine with Intent to Distribute, and Possession of Marijuana.
The Tennile Police Department and the State Probation Office are assisting in the investigation.
